I would do a French bread style pizza. Slice the bread crosswise and scoop out the middle (I would say use it for something like breadcrumbs, but who am I kidding? I would eat it). Then, saute some mushrooms and onions, mix with a few diced tomatoes (canned would work), and put the filling into the bread. Cheese on top (I love fontina, but whatever you have) and into the oven for a few minutes to melt it . . . yum. Salad on the side. And a few slabs of chicken for your hubs. ;)
